Disinfectant by-product
Monochloroacetic acid
A synthetic chemical primarily used in industrial applications such as the production of carboxymethyl cellulose, herbicides, and dyes. Not intended for food use. Known to be corrosive and toxic with potential for causing skin burns, respiratory tract irritation, and systemic toxicity upon exposure.
